2014年12月11日木曜日

Org-mode で C-c C-e l 押下でLaTeXに\ エクスポートできなくなった時の話


1 Org-mode で C-c C-e l 押下でLaTeXにエクスポートできなくなった時の話   gblog



Org-mode で LaTeX へエクスポートしようと C-c C-e l 押下すると, Symbol's function definition is void: org-e-latex-export-to-latex とか言われたので場当たり的に対処

半年か一年か放ったらかしになっていた古いEmacs, Org-mode の設定で,Gentoo さんがバシバシアップデートしてくれるEmacs とOrg-mode を使えばやっぱり問題が起きるわけで.

とりあえず,対処療法的に問題が見つかったら潰している感じ.

今回は,Org-mode C-c C-e l でLaTeX をエクスポートしようとしたら, Symbol's function definition is void: org-e-latex-export-to-latex と言われたので対処.




1.1 環境



現環境



  • Emacs version: GNU Emacs 24.4.1


  • Org-mode version: Org-mode version 8.2.6



以前使ってた環境(うろ覚え)



  • Emacs version: GNU Emacs 23.4 くらいだったような気がする


  • Org-mode version: 7.9.3 くらいだったような気がする






1.2 org-e-latex-export-to-latex って何?



昔の Org-mode の Contrib の中にある関数らしい.

どうやら設定ファイルの中で古い Org-mode の Contrib を呼び出してるのがまずいらしい.






1.3 問題回避(解決したとは言ってない)



以前,org-md (Markdown へのエクスポートなどの機能を提供する) を試すために,org-mode/contrib/lisp をロードしていたが,正直全く使ってない.

なので,とりあえず今回は org-mode/contrib/lisp のロードをやめるようにした.

これで,=C-c C-e l l= でLaTeX へエクスポートされるようになった.






--
My Emacs Files At GitHub